WhatsApp: +86 18203695377WEBMay 7, 2007 · The wet beneficiation process for coal cleaning is currently the predominant method of purifiion of coal in the world. However, dry beneficiation of coal has obvious advantages over wet processes. The dry processes for coal are based on the physical properties of coal and its associated mineral matters. WhatsApp: +86 18203695377WEBFeb 28, 2017 · This usually involves filtration, centrifuging, natural drainage or, in very rare cases, thermal dewatering. The problem becomes worse for the fine coal fractions. Pollution is another serious result of wet processes and any plant effluent or wet discard impacts the environment in a variety of ways. WhatsApp: +86 18203695377WEBBoth methods yield a dry final product, collected in particulate control devices for further treatment. Wet FGD. The process of wet scrubbing typically utilizes an alkalinebased slurry of lime to scrub gases. A shower of lime slurry is then sprayed into a flue gas scrubber, where the SO 2 is absorbed into the spray and becomes a wet calcium ...

WhatsApp: +86 18203695377WEB1 Scope. This International Standard specifies reference methods for the size analysis of coal by manual sieving (wet or dry), using test sieves of aperture sizes between 125 mm and 45 μm. A guide to sampling is given in Annex A. This International Standard is applicable to all hard coals. It is not applicable to coke or other manufactured fuels.
